WebJul 1, 2024 · The minimum pension drawdown rate is the amount you’re required to withdraw from your Rest Pension Retirement or Transition to Retirement account each year. It’s a percentage of your starting balance on 1 July of the current financial year, and depends on your age. This minimum rate has been temporarily reduced since 1 July 2024.

WebEligible low-income earners with an adjusted taxable income of $37,000 or less receive a LISTO contribution to their super fund of 15% of their total concessional super contributions, capped at $500. (Adjusted taxable income includes taxable income plus any tax offsets for dependants and any government benefits received.) WebThe minimum drawdown rate is currently 3.0 per cent for ages 75-79, 3.5 per cent for ages 80-84, 4.5 per cent for ages 85-89, 5.5 per cent for ages 90-94 and 7 per cent for ages 95 and above, while a rate of 2 per cent applies to those under 65. The government should be helping people see and use superannuation as primarily for spending during retirement, including making safe financial advice more affordable and changing consumer disclosure rules to have a more drawdown focus, according to new research from the FSC.
